What to look for in a pre built Gaming PC

If you look for a gaming PC the first thing that you have to consider is the graphics card. We already discussed the graphics card and what to look for when you buy a new one. What I am going to highlight here, in particular, is the memory factor.

The memory in a GPU is very important when it comes to gaming. The higher is the memory the higher will be the resolution of your video games. On the market, the range of memory goes between 2 and 12 GB. If you want to have a better gaming experience, you will need probably to go for a higher memory size.

Another essential factor is the processor. Brand-wise there are 2 choices: Inter or AMD. What to say… both of them are good options and there’s no doubt about it. They are always competing with each other. There is not much difference in terms of performances. If money is not an issue you better go for the latest generation of Intel Core processors (9th or 10th) or AMD Ryzen ones.

Alienware Aurora R11

Alienware is getting all the points and props for building the next generation cyberpower gaming desktop with support up to the latest 10-gen intel processors and liquid cooling technology in super-powerful graphics cards.

With a wide range of supporting processors, you can select the desired requirements without denting your wallet. If you are looking for an upgrade and enjoy all the ray-tracing games, Alienware R11 can be the perfect upgrade and you can make the adjustments according to your budget.

Aurora R11 comes with a variety of processors from i5 10400F to i9 10900 so you can adjust the performance according to your desires. With support up to RTX 2080 super, you can get an extreme 4K gaming experience without even flinching. Storage capabilities are massive as well with support up to 2 TB SSD and 2 TB HDD which is more than enough to accommodate all the latest games and heavy software. The R11 design is a perfect upgrade as compared to R9 with a stylish build and easy access to the components.

Finally, this feature allows you to upgrade even if you want to pack an extra punch. RAM capabilities are more than enough with a range from 8 GB to 32 GB to run all the games and rendering programs smoothly.

HP Omen Obelisk

Enough talk about Alienware and ASUS. Let’s jump to HP as they introduced a monster gaming rig named as HP Omen Obelisk. The black cube design with powerful components is the reason for its Obelisk name.

The transparent glass on the side allows you to have a crystal view of all the components and you can decorate to make it fancier and life-like.

The design is sleek, powerful, and compact. Liquid cooling rig with RGB lights is food for the eyes and if you are running the gig daily, you surely will take a moment to see how the liquid cooling setup kicks in and enhances the beauty of the rig.

Processing power ranging from i5-8400 to i9-9900 depending on your budget and requirement. 1 TB NVMe SSD and up to 3 TB of HDD storage are ample for firing up the rig in seconds and storing all the powerful games. DDR4 Ram never let your system to bottleneck and affect the performance in any way. The beast GPU RTX 2080 will give you maximum gaming experience at extreme settings. The obelisk may be smaller as compared to other gaming rigs, but it is not tiny by any means. The sleek design allows it to fit in any gaming table and you can show off the cool liquid cooling setup and RGB lights to brag in front of your friends.
